The 1851-8866 QMA 10 Quartz Paper Whatman Microfiber Filter is a high-quality, advanced filtration solution designed for laboratory and scientific applications. This filter is made from a unique blend of quartz and microfiber materials, providing exceptional filtration efficiency and durability.
The QMA material in this filter is a type of quartz fiber, known for its exceptional strength and resistance to chemical and thermal degradation. This makes it an ideal choice for applications that involve harsh chemicals or high temperatures.
The microfiber component of the filter is another key feature. Microfibers are extremely fine, with diameters in the range of 0.1 to 10 micrometers. This allows the filter to capture particles that are much smaller than what can be captured by traditional filters. The high surface area of the microfibers also increases the filter's efficiency, ensuring that even the smallest particles are captured.
The 10 quartz paper thickness of this filter provides an additional layer of protection and durability. Quartz paper is a high-density filter medium, which means it can handle high flow rates and high particle loads without clogging or compromising filtration efficiency.
